YOUR TASKS:
  • Perform on-site preventative maintenance and troubleshooting of facilities equipment and CVD reactors
  • Create and execute plans for installation of new and replacement equipment
  • Maintain logs, document, and report equipment conditions accurately
  • Manage hazardous waste collection and disposal
  • Ensure regulatory compliance with government agencies including fire department, wastewater, etc.
  • Collaborate with production and engineering teams to address quality issues and improve processes
  • Supervise outside contractors and service providers as needed: electricians, plumbers, etc.
  • Follow established procedures for quality assurance and safety standards
  • Assist with other duties as assigned to support overall production
  • Assist with manufacture of CVD systems for customers and internal use
YOUR PROFILE:
  • Excellent technical knowledge of industrial equipment systems, including process cooling water, compressed air, process gasses, electrical, mechanical, chemical handling, plumbing, etc.
  • Basic understanding of vacuum systems and CVD (or other semiconductor) tools is a plus
  • Experience with hand tools, power tools, electrical multimeter, and associated safety procedures
  • Clean room, machine shop, or fabrication experience is a plus
  • Ability to climb ladders and work at elevated heights; ability to work in confined spaces; ability to move equipment weighing up to 50 lbs.
  • Proficiency in basic computer skills, including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ook)
  • High school diploma or equivalent; technical training or certification is a plus
